1. Floating Champagne Bar

Upgrade your party drinks with a floating champagne bar! Use inflatable drink holders and floating trays to keep bottles of bubbly and colorful flutes within arm’s reach.
Add some fruit garnishes and even freeze edible flowers into ice cubes. This makes the experience feel luxe without lifting a finger. Plus, it keeps the drinks cold and the vibes hot.
2. Poolside Mimosa Bar

Turn a corner of your pool deck into a mimosa station. Set out chilled bubbly, different juices (like mango, guava, and orange), and fruit slices for garnishes.
Let guests mix their own drinks and enjoy a personalized sip while lounging poolside. This self-serve bar also keeps things easy on the host!
3. Bride’s Cabana Chill Zone

Set up a luxe cabana or tented area just for the bride. Deck it out with white drapes, gold accents, plush pillows, and a mini fan.
It’s her private spot to relax, take photos, or sip champagne like royalty. Bonus points if you add a little “Bride Vibes Only” sign out front.
4. Flamingo Fun Decor

Nothing says pool party like pink flamingos! Add inflatable flamingo floats, flamingo drink stirrers, and matching tableware. You can even give out mini flamingo rings as party favors.
This playful and photo-friendly setup adds charm without much effort. It also looks fantastic in photos.

5. Floatie Parade

Get creative with giant pool floats that match your party vibe—unicorns, diamonds, flamingos, pizzas, you name it.
Host a “floatie parade” where each girl picks her favorite and takes a glam shot. It’s fun, hilarious, and a visual treat for your party feed!
6. Spa Station by the Pool

Add a calm contrast to all the fun with a mini spa area. Include face masks, cold cucumber eye pads, mini foot soaks, and chilled rosewater sprays. Guests can pamper themselves between dips. It’s especially perfect if the bride loves a little self-care.

7. Glow-in-the-Dark Night Swim

Turn the pool party into a nighttime rave with glow-in-the-dark elements. Add LED floating lights, glow sticks, and waterproof neon balloons.
Play some EDM or chill house music. Everyone can wear glow bracelets or body paint. It’s a magical way to end the day.
8. Themed Cocktail Hour

Choose a signature drink and name it after the bride. Think “Jenny’s Julep” or “Bride’s Berry Blast.”
Serve it in cute mason jars or flamingo tumblers. Add custom drink stirrers for that personal touch. It’s a great way to toast the bride in style.
9. Inflatable Movie Night

As the sun sets, turn the pool into a float-in theater. Rent or DIY an inflatable movie screen and stream rom-coms or wedding classics like Bridesmaids or Mamma Mia!. Everyone can relax on pool floats with popcorn and candy bags.
10. Barbiecore Pool Party

If your bride’s style is bold and pink, a Barbiecore pool party is perfect. Think hot pink everything—towels, drinks, sunglasses, and floats. Add Barbie-themed decorations, and ask everyone to wear their most fabulous Barbie-inspired swimwear.

11. Under the Sea Mermaid Theme

Make waves with a mermaid-inspired bash. Use sea-shell floats, iridescent tablecloths, pearl balloons, and mermaid tail towels. Offer glittery face paint or stick-on scales for full fantasy vibes. You can even get temporary mermaid tattoos as party favors.
12. Poolside Picnic Brunch

Turn brunch into a floating feast. Lay out picnic tables or trays near the pool with croissants, fruit skewers, and yogurt parfaits. Pair it with bubbly and cute brunch signage. It’s a calm, tasty way to start the day before jumping into the water.
13. Mini-Pool for Pups

If your bride’s a dog lover, invite a few furry friends and create a “doggy splash zone” with mini pools and treats. Just be sure everyone’s okay with dogs attending! It’s wholesome, adorable, and brings even more love to the event.
14. Confetti Cannons for the Bride

Surprise the bride with biodegradable confetti cannons while she’s floating or dancing. It’s a fun, unexpected way to mark a toast, a game win, or a key moment. Bonus: it makes for a magical mid-party video.
